Determinants of Fitness App Usage and Moderating Impacts of Education-, Motivation-, and Gamification-Related App Features on Physical Activity Intentions: Cross-sectional Survey Study
BACKGROUND: Smartphone fitness apps are considered promising tools for promoting physical activity and health.
